What is the correct way to write a number?
A simple rule for using numbers in writing is that small numbers ranging from one to ten (or one to nine, depending on the style guide) should generally be spelled out. Larger numbers (i.e., above ten) are written as numerals.

Where do you put the hyphen in numbers?
You should always hyphenate numbers when you are describing compound numbers between 21 and 99 (except 30, 40, 50, 60, 70, 80 and 90). A compound number is any number that consists of two words. For example, eighty-eight, twenty-two, forty-nine. Numbers higher than 99 do not need a hyphen.
Do you put a hyphen between numbers and words?
When numbers are used as the first part of a compound adjective, use a hyphen to connect them to the noun that follows them. This way, the reader knows that both words function like a unit to modify another noun. However, a hyphen is not required if the number is the second word in the compound adjective.
Do you hyphenate numbers with units?
Spelled-out numbers or numerals with units of time that don't appear directly before a noun in other words, those that aren't acting as compound adjectives don't need to be hyphenated. However, double-digit numbers (e.g., forty-one, ninety-nine) should maintain their normal internal hyphenation.

How do you hyphenate inches?
In one and a half inches, inches is not modified by a number + noun phrase. It is merely modified by a number: one and a half. Therefore, no hyphens.
